I stumbled over the following page when reading about color management in browsers:
http://foto.beitinger.de/browser_farbmanagement/
the picture with the text "Rot - Grün - Blau" and "Falls dieses Bild in seltsamen Farben angezeigt wird, unterstützt anzeigende Software kein Farbmanagement"
isn't displayed correctly in
*) the chromium web browser 5.0.322.0 (38532)
*) midori, epiphany (with webkit-gtk 1.1.21)
*) arora 0.10.2 and qt-webkit 4.6.1
what is supposed to be green is being shown as violet/purple
the picture seems to be displayed correctly with firefox 3.6 [the colors match those of the real world / a photograph]
I don't know in what way this possibly could be "fixed" or if this is a duplicate of another - I just wanted to let you guys know that there's a problem
